Great idea..Maybe...How well would this work?
 
I would love to get some feedback on this.......

We all know the Mogul is limited in program memory, and personally, I don't like to ask it to do more than absolutely necessary because I want it to run smoothly. Also, anyone that's used the 3.16 ROM has noticed that more program memory is allocated to the OS.

To quote someone here...I hard reset like a *****, and I keep a backup of all of the folders in "My documents" on my storage card and I copy/paste them back after the hard reset.

So, I was thinking that I could potentially install every game, application, program, utility, etc. that I want and then copy all of the installed program files to my card...then hard reset. I use SPB PocketPlus to launch all of my programs from the today screen. I could copy the backup of the installed files onto the device and link the exe. files using SPB PP. Essentially, I could have all my games, utilities, and programs on my device, launched from the today screen, without having any of them "installed".

I realize that some applications will actually need to be installed (i.e. SPB PP. SPB MS, along with a few others)

I guess the question I have is, why wouldn't this work?

Re: Great idea..Maybe...How well would this work?
 
Some programs may need to place supporting files (DLL's, Config Files) on your device in order to run. It really depends on how the program was written which will determine if this is the case (SPB is one like you said).

Some programs will need to place registry entries/edits.. and by Hard resetting you will lose these... Some entries are not so important (path to saved files for example).. and some are more important. Depends on the program.

And some programs were not written so well... the developer didn't think/know how/or care to implement the ability to reside solely on the storage card.

Only way to find out is to try :) I think your Idea could work with a number of programs (Warfare Inc will work after a hard reset solely on the card). But there will be a number that will not work.
